Transaction 59109e2abd88daea03d64e112ffc0056a08eda76bb8acf5a8e96926e98b5b01c
1 Input
2 Outputs
- 59109e2abd88daea03d64e112ffc0056a08eda76bb8acf5a8e96926e98b5b01c:0
- 59109e2abd88daea03d64e112ffc0056a08eda76bb8acf5a8e96926e98b5b01c:1
value 2000000
address 15bhUewhABPdQHpyfwx2QVVoCwYKtv1HpF
value 418888
address bc1pwy7t80cpu7wvrq0tpry7fe3y4rvud4xrk7k98ejxp5r09mf656xqktn95r